Infinity-Edge Pool

If you want to take a standard in-ground pool up a notch, head to infinity and beyond! An infinity-edge pool essentially has water flowing over one edge, creating the effect of the pool blending into the surrounding landscape or setting. The water cascading over the edge makes a super-relaxing sound, too.

But buyer beware: Adding an infinity edge to an in-ground pool can increase the cost by as much as 20 percent.

Plunge Pool

A plunge pool is a small pool for relaxing and refreshing.  Plunge pools offer homeowners a quick-to-install, easy-to-maintain alternative to traditional in-ground pools. It’s too small for swimming. Instead, it’s an area for getting wet and cooling off, for kids to play, and for aqua-aerobics or water rehabilitation.

Lap Pool

If your motivation for building an in-ground pool is primarily to exercise at home, then a lap pool might be a smart option. Lap pools are long and narrow and typically the same depth throughout — deep enough to allow average-sized adults to swim and do laps without kicking the pool bottom. A lap pool is also a good choice to consider if you’re building a pool in a narrow or shallow backyard.
